Your Best Guide to Sustainability in 2026

By Voucherix-C Leave a Comment

Sustainability in 2026 is no longer just a buzzword—it’s a way of life. From how we design our homes to the products we buy and the habits we adopt, sustainable choices are shaping a greener, more responsible future. As climate awareness grows, individuals and businesses alike are finding practical ways to reduce waste, save energy, and live more consciously without sacrificing comfort or style.

A Shift Towards Smarter Living

One of the biggest sustainability trends in 2026 is smarter living. People are investing in technology to monitor energy use, water consumption, and waste output. Smart meters, automated lighting, and energy-efficient appliances are now considered essentials rather than luxuries. These innovations make it easier to reduce environmental impact while also lowering household bills, proving that sustainability and savings often go hand in hand.

Sustainable Home Design Takes Centre Stage

Eco-friendly home design continues to evolve, focusing on durability, efficiency, and timeless appeal. Sustainable materials such as recycled timber, bamboo, low-VOC paints, and natural stone are widely used in modern homes. Better insulation, triple-glazed windows, and passive heating solutions are helping households cut energy usage year-round. The goal in 2026 is to build and renovate homes that last longer, perform better, and create healthier living environments.

Water Conservation Without Compromise

Water conservation remains a top priority, especially in residential spaces. Low-flow taps, dual-flush toilets, and water-saving shower systems are now standard in many homes. Interestingly, luxury and sustainability are no longer at odds. Modern whirlpool baths, for example, are designed to be far more efficient than older models, using improved circulation systems and better insulation to retain heat and reduce water waste. This allows homeowners to enjoy relaxation while still being mindful of their environmental footprint.

The Rise of Sustainable Wellness

Wellness and sustainability are becoming deeply connected in 2026. More people are creating personal wellness spaces at home using e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ient systems. Features such as infrared saunas, steam showers, and whirlpool baths are being manufactured with sustainability as a priority, using recyclable components and lower energy consumption. The focus is on long-term wellbeing—for both people and the planet—rather than short-term indulgence.

Conscious Consumer Choices Matter More Than Ever

Consumers in 2026 are paying closer attention to where products come from and how they’re made. Ethical sourcing, minimal packaging, and transparent supply chains are influencing purchasing decisions across all industries. Brands that prioritise sustainability are earning greater trust and loyalty. Whether it’s choosing locally made goods or investing in long-lasting products instead of fast replacements, every conscious decision contributes to a more sustainable future.

Sustainability as a Daily Habit

Perhaps the most important shift in 2026 is the understanding that sustainability is built on everyday habits. Simple actions such as properly recycling, reducing food waste, repairing rather than replacing, and conserving energy all make a meaningful difference over time. These small but consistent efforts, when adopted widely, have the power to create lasting environmental change.

Looking Ahead to a Greener Future

Sustainability in 2026 is all about balance—combining innovation, comfort, and responsibility. With smarter homes, efficient wellness features like whirlpool baths, and more informed consumer choices, living sustainably has never been more achievable. By embracing these changes today, we move closer to a future that supports both modern living and the well-being of our planet.
